Output 3b072d1112cd809c2e5681a883b8843ee471bdf929f30c5e8144df55300b28c1:1

value
637104340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efe8b7b4d39b86930f1dfd84a1e1aa23c68a4bb OP_EQUAL
address
34Wu8PH7DMNphqrkK6bpsLqeaf1RHhofq8
transaction
3b072d1112cd809c2e5681a883b8843ee471bdf929f30c5e8144df55300b28c1
spent
true